Deferred from military service, Henry Chinaski drifts from city to city, scraping by on odd jobs and casual encounters. His ambitions fade into a blur of cheap hotels and dive bars as he drowns his frustrations in a relentless cycle of pathetic whores, sordid rooms, and drunken brawls. Yet beneath the degenerate surface, Chinaski's search for meaning persists, even in the face of overwhelming hopelessness.
